How to make this Meatloaf with Mashed Potatoes and Cheese:
Step 1. Heat the oven to 400 degrees.
Step 2. In a skillet over medium heat, cook 1 chopped onion, and 3 tsp of garlic in 1 tbsp of oil until softened. Remove and let cool.

Step 3. Add ½ cup frozen peas, ¾ cup breadcrumbs, 1 ½ lb. beef, ground, 1 large egg, ¼ cup parsley, chopped and salt and pepper to taste to a mixing bowl with the onions, and knead with your hands until well combined.

Then, add ¼ cup Tomato Sauce.

Then, add ¼ cup BBQ Sauce.

Step 4. Form the mixture into a loaf shape in a 9×13 baking dish. Bake for 30 minutes.

Step 5. While the meatloaf is baking, boil the potatoes until tender. Drain the water.

Step 6. Add in the butter and heavy whipping cream as well as salt and pepper to taste. Mash well.

Step 7. Spread the mashed potatoes on the meatloaf, and top with the cheese.

Step 8. Bake for an additional 20 minutes.!

Meatloaf with Mashed Potatoes and Cheese

Ingredients
For the meatloaf:
-
1 Onion, Chopped
-
1 tbsp. Olive Oil
-
½ cup Frozen Peas
-
¾ cup Breadcrumbs
-
3 tsp. Garlic, Minced
-
1 ½ lb. Beef, Ground
-
1 Large Egg
-
¼ cup Tomato Sauce
-
¼ cup Parsley, Chopped
-
¼ cup BBQ Sauce
-
Salt And Pepper To Taste
For the potatoes:
-
1 ½ Lb Potatoes, peeled, cubed
-
¼ cup Heavy Whipping Cream
-
4 tbsp. Butter
-
Salt And Pepper To Taste
-
1 cup Cheddar Cheese, Shredded
Instructions
-
Heat the oven to 400 degrees.
-
In a skillet over medium heat, cook the onions and garlic in the oil until softened. Remove and let cool.
-
Add the remaining ingredients for the meatloaf to a mixing bowl with the onions, and knead with your hands until well combined.
-
Form the mixture into a loaf shape in a 9×13 baking dish. Bake for 30 minutes.
-
While the meatloaf is baking, boil the potatoes until tender. Drain the water.
-
Add in the butter and heavy whipping cream as well as salt and pepper to taste. Mash well.
-
Spread the mashed potatoes on the meatloaf, and top with the cheese. Bake for an additional 20 minutes.
